
Holiday houses in Ruby Lake
Find and book unique accommodation on Airbnb
Top-rated holiday rentals in Ruby Lake
Guests agree: these stays are highly rated for location, cleanliness and more.
0 of 0 items showing
1 of 3 pages
Holiday rentals for every style
Get the amount of space that is right for you
Popular amenities for Ruby Lake holiday rentals
Other great holiday rentals in Ruby Lake
Top Guest favourite

Home in Garden Bay
5 out of 5 average rating, 56 reviewsSerene Oasis with a Salty Breeze!
Top Guest favourite

Guest suite in Bowen Island
5 out of 5 average rating, 66 reviewsCozy Cabin w/ Sauna, Fire, Gym, Patio & Ocean View
Top Guest favourite

Cottage in Halfmoon Bay
4.94 out of 5 average rating, 99 reviews#slowtravel Forest Spa Hot tub, Cold Plunge, Beach
Top Guest favourite

Guesthouse in Hornby Island
5 out of 5 average rating, 29 reviewsNORRA HEM - Cliffside Guesthouse on Hornby Island
Superhost

Cabin in Egmont
4.63 out of 5 average rating, 8 reviewsCoastal Cabin for 2
Top Guest favourite

Guesthouse in Halfmoon Bay
4.97 out of 5 average rating, 38 reviewsLittle cabin in Middlepoint, Pender Harbour
Top Guest favourite

Home in Gibsons
4.96 out of 5 average rating, 94 reviewsBrand New Oceanfront Mountain View Studio
Top Guest favourite

Guest suite in Powell River
5 out of 5 average rating, 64 reviewsBy the Beach
Destinations to explore
- Vancouver Holiday rentals
- Seattle Holiday rentals
- Fraser River Holiday rentals
- Portland Holiday rentals
- Puget Sound Holiday rentals
- Vancouver Island Holiday rentals
- Whistler Holiday rentals
- Victoria Holiday rentals
- Greater Vancouver Holiday rentals
- Kelowna Holiday rentals
- Richmond Holiday rentals
- Tofino Holiday rentals
- University of British Columbia
- Tribune Bay Provincial Park
- BC Place
- Jericho Beach
- Tribune Bay Beach
- Rathtrevor Beach Provincial Park
- English Bay Beach
- Point Grey Golf & Country Club
- Vancouver Aquarium
- Shaughnessy Golf & Country Club
- Cypress Mountain
- Point Grey Beach
- Neck Point Park
- Parksville Beaches
- Museum of Vancouver
- Wreck Beach
- Capilano Golf and Country Club
- Squamish Valley Golf & Country Club
- Nanaimo Golf Club
- Vancouver Seawall
- Spanish Banks Beach
- Second Beach
- Jericho Beach
- Wall Beach